Account Deactivated With No Violations And Can't Appeal

Hello,

When I recently tried to start selling products on my page for the first time, I realized I had an old account I never used. When I logged in, however, it said the account was deactivated. When I clicked the "Reactivate Account" button, it just took me to a page that said I needed to resolve all violations before I could apply for reactivation. The issue is I've never sold a product and there are no violations on the account. I cannot appeal anything or fix anything. I tried submitting a help request but was just told to submit an appeal, which I have no way of doing.

Attached is what II see when i try to reactivate the account.

Any help at all would be greatly appreciated.

"it just took me to a page that said I needed to resolve all violations before I could apply for reactivation."

Not all violations show up in the health pages. Some of the most serious ones never do -- they are at an entirely different level!

"I realized I had an old account I never used."

So, you now have TWO accounts?

If so, THAT original account is the one that needs to be fixed and reinstated. Did you receive any notifications when you had opened it?

Sometimes (difficult to tell in this situation) it can be as simple as a bad credit card --

This is my standard credit card template so use what applies!

Amazon is weird on so many levels and this seems to work at least sometimes!

First, be sure it is an actual CREDIT Card. While Amazon claims that a Debit Card will work, that is seldom true! They WILL charge a Debit Card for initial fees but they will NOT take it on continuing basis most of the time despite their claims!

Put the card number into your BUYER side account first. Wait an hour (sometimes less) for the gerbils to work their way through the system and then put it in the SELLER side.

There was one recent response from a seller on a post that they DELETED the card that was on the buyer side and put the SAME card back in after a little bit and it fixed the problem. Amazon is a maze of broken links in their antiquated software.
